Experience & Skills

FILM & TV


Carolyn brings a wealth of experience to every project. Her credits include Associate Producer, Researcher, Archive Producer, Field Producer, and more recently Director and Producer.

Much like a Swiss Army knife, she has a versatile skillset which includes: in-depth & investigative research, story development, pitching, casting, interviewing subjects, working closely with writers & editors, fact-checking, script editing, archive producing, film producing and direction.


JOURNALISM & WRITING

Carolyn's proficiency to conduct meaningful interviews & adapt to different environments, combined with her strong network of contacts comes from her journalism background.

She's covered wide range of contemporary social issues and has been widely featured in the media including Sydney Morning Herald, The Age, SBS, news.com.au, VICE, HuffPost, The Weekly Times and Broadsheet


ACADEMIC & INDUSTRY RESEARCH

Carolyn's academic work has been formally recognised in the landmark report WHO GETS TO TELL AUSTRALIAN STORIES (Deakin University), and in an upcoming report looking at INCENTIVISING AUSTRALIAN SCREEN DIVERSITY (Monash University).

Combining her academic skills and passion for creating a more diverse screen industry, she has also alongside the SBS Commissioning Team as a DEI Researcher, contributing to the SBS Commissioning Guidelines


RECOGNITION

Over the years, her dedication to authentic and powerful storytelling and hard work has been recognised, including by SBS to undertake a 12-month Screen Producers Australia program, AIDC's Leading Lights, in AA122's Honours List, as a finalist for Melbourne Queer Film Festival’s Pitch Pleez and the Victorian Pride Awards.

Her directorial debut, My First Time has recently won Best Documentary at the Los Angeles LGBTQ+ Film Festival, and been official selected for festivals around the world including London, Chicago & San Fran.
